Which TM HOTAS are you using? Are you using a Warthog or the T.16000M FCS HOTAS?
This makes a big difference in setup.

the T.16000M stick has great resolution, but there aren’t any modifications available for extension or spring removal, and any you would make anyway would void the warranty.

I used to use a (2) T.16000M setup heavily modified for SC and all of my sims. Both had springs removed, some 3D printed addons and strategic plastic removal.

Try bumping up the helicopter stability. All of the settings sliders are intended to allow different users to get the best experience with the control setup that they already have. None of the setting changes mean that there is less realism.
